845786-35-8

845786-35-8 structure
845786-35-8 structure

Name methyl 2-(2-(2-(tert-butyldiphenylsilyl)ethoxy)phenyl)acetate
Molecular Formula C27H32O3Si
Molecular Weight 432.62700
Exact Mass 432.21200
PSA 35.53000
LogP 4.84420
Precursor  0

DownStream  1